Thanks for asking @CandiceMarie! Mom is doing much better. She's at home, recovering from the dental surgery she had to have before they can fix her aortic valve. She gets tired awfully quickly, and her medications make her a bit woozy, but she is going to be fine once she has surgery for her heart. She's chosen the TAVR, which is kind of like a stent for heart valves, and they will put it in going from an artery in her groin! So she doesn't have to have actual open-heart surgery. She will be in ICU for probably 6 hours, and the hospital for probably 4 days, then once she is released to home, she will have no restrictions at all. It's a much easier recovery than open-heart surgery. They just pop and brand new heart valve into the space where the old one is, and they puff it up with a balloon. It's ready to go as soon as it's inflated. While there are still risks, apparently the risks are lower with this procedure. So I'm hoping all will be well soon.
